Alejandro Primo

Alejandro Primo is a Spanish goalkeeper, aged 21, who plays for Levante UD in La Liga. As one of the youngest players in the squad profile, he occupies a role that is technically unforgiving but also highly developmental. Goalkeeping requires patience, concentration and a strong understanding of defensive organisation, all of which become more refined with experience.

The goalkeeper’s job goes far beyond stopping shots. Primo must be prepared to command his area, communicate with defenders and contribute to the team’s build-up through accurate distribution. In a league like La Liga, where teams often press intelligently and attack with structure, a goalkeeper’s decisions can have major tactical consequences.
